查看订单进行 checkout 时,某些图像会消失

6mw9ycah  于 2021-09-29  发布在  Java
关注(0)|答案(0)|浏览(263)

当我在vue.js中单击review order作为前端,在后端单击ruby时,我需要帮助检索缺少的渲染图像。在添加到 checkout 列表之前,三个图像中只有一个渲染图像。我已经运行了chrome开发工具,在这段代码中,我看到缺少这些图像:

  1. : ((upload = false), (preview_url = blank_url));
  2. this.reviewOrderDisabled = true;
  3. this.$store.commit("changeIfReorder", false);
  4. let user_id = this.$store.getters.id;
  5. this.saveDraftDisabled = true;
  6. this.selectedProduct.img_url = this.artwork_url;
  7. this.$store.commit("changeSelected", this.selectedProduct);
  8. MockupService.saveProductTemplate(
  9. this.productTemplate.id,
  10. this.layers,
  11. preview_url,
  12. this.artwork_url,
  13. this.previewImgObjs,
  14. upload,
  15. user_id,
  16. blank_url
  17. )
  18. .then((data) => {
  19. console.log(
  20. "data from product template save::: " + JSON.stringify(data)
  21. );
  22. this.saveDraftDisabled = false;
  23. this.save_success = true;
  24. this.save_msg =
  25. "This draft was saved to Product Templates in your Dashboard.";
  26. var layer = data.data.layers.layers[0];
  27. if (layer) {
  28. this.$store.commit("changeImgUrl", layer);
  29. }
  30. if (this.file.image) {
  31. window.location = "/product/checkout/null&isPaid=false";
  32. }
  33. // }
  34. })
  35. .catch((error) => {
  36. this.saveDraftDisabled = false;
  37. // this.error =
  38. // "There was an error in saving your draft. Please try again later.";
  39. });
  40. },
  41. hide() {
  42. this.showModal = false;

如果有人能帮助我,我将不胜感激。提前谢谢

暂无答案!

目前还没有任何答案,快来回答吧!

相关问题